Almost 100 sailors will tow Queen Elizabeth ‘s coffin on a 123-year-old gun carriage using white ropes at the funeral procession to Westminster Abbey in London on Monday. It will be pulled by a team of 98 Royal Navy sailors known as the Sovereign’s Guard, while 40 sailors march behind the carriage to act as a brake, in a tradition dating back to the funeral of Queen Victoria in 1901.

On Wednesday, the coffin was taken from Buckingham Palace to Westminster Hall, within the Palace of Westminster, in a military procession with King Charles leading other royals walking behind. The queen is lying in state until early Monday, when the coffin will be taken the short distance to Westminster Abbey for the state funeral, which will be attended by 2,000 royals, world leaders, dignitaries and invited guests,

Final preparations for the funeral are taking place in London. Overnight, thousands of military personnel held a full rehearsal for the procession.

King Charles, William, and Harry Walk Behind the Queen’s Coffin at Her State Funeral King Charles III led senior royals walking behind the coffin of his mother, Queen Elizabeth II coffin, at her today. He was joined by his siblings and his sons, the Prince of Wales and the Duke of Sussex, in the procession from Westminster Hall, where the coffin has been lying in state, to Westminster Abbey for the funeral service.

It was an emotional echo of a scene from 25 years ago, when the young William and Harry walked behind their mother Princess Diana’s coffin, following her tragic death in a car accident in 1997. King Charles III and the Princess Royal walked behind their mother’s coffin as it was conveyed from Westminster Hall to Westminster Abbey for the state funeral.

Photo: Getty Images The Princess Royal and her husband, Vice Admiral Sir Timothy Laurence, the Duke of York, and the Earl and Countess of Wessex also walked behind the Queen’s coffin, as it was carried to Westminster Abbey on the State Gun Carriage. The coffin was accompanied by the bearer party of the Grenadier Guards, the King’s Body Guards of the Honourable Corps of Gentlemen at Arms, the Yeomen of the Guard, and the Royal Company of Archers.

When the procession entered Westminster Abbey, the Princess of Wales joined to walk alongside her husband, along with their two eldest children, Prince George, nine, and Princess Charlotte, seven. Their little brother, four-year-old Prince Louis, was deemed too young to join. Now that their father is first in line to the throne, the young royals will likely play a more prominent role on carefully selected occasions.

Meghan, the Duchess of Sussex, also joined the procession walking behind the coffin as it entered the church, beside her husband Prince Harry. : King Charles, William, and Harry Walk Behind the Queen’s Coffin at Her State Funeral

The King and his two sons reunited to walk behind the Queen’s coffin as she left Buckingham Palace for the last time. King Charles, the Prince of Wales and Duke of Sussex accompanied the monarch on the journey to Westminster Hall for her lying in state. Crowds of mourners applauded as the Queen’s coffin and the procession moved past them. William stared straight ahead as he walked directly behind his father, the King, in keeping with his place as the heir to the throne. Watch our live stream as the Queen lies in state The King and his children were joined by the Duke of York, the Princess Royal and the Earl of Wessex, as well as Anne’s son Peter Phillips, her husband Vice Admiral Sir Tim Laurence, the Duke of Gloucester and the Earl of Snowdon. The Queen Consort, Princess of Wales, Countess of Wessex and Duchess of Sussex travelled by car. The procession left the palace at 2.22pm and arrived at Westminster Hall at 3pm. Big Ben tolled at one-minute intervals as the procession made its way to the Palace of Westminster. The Queen’s coffin was then placed on the catafalque in Westminster Hall to lie in state until her funeral on Monday. The Archbishop of Canterbury, accompanied by the Dean of Westminster, led the service to the Queen. Image: Pic: AP Image: Pic: AP The senior royals stood in formation facing the coffin during the service, which was flanked with a tall yellow flickering candle at each corner of the platform. The King and Queen Consort stood together around a metre apart, with the Princess Royal and Vice Admiral Sir Tim Laurence behind them, then the Duke of York alone, and the Earl and Countess of Wessex in the next row. Prince Harry is still a prince and a duke, but he will no longer be known as His Royal Highness.Today, the royal family updated its to reflect some of the royals’ current titles, and among other things, removed references to Harry’s “His Royal Highness” title. The website still makes some references to Queen Elizabeth II being the current monarch, and at times calls now-King Charles III “the Prince of Wales” and Queen Camilla “the Duchess of Cornwall,” but per the palace, updates are being made periodically.

Buckingham Palace said in a statement reported by : “The Royal Family website contains over five thousand pages of information about the life and work of the Royal Family. Following the death of Her late Majesty Queen Elizabeth II, content has been revisited and updated periodically.

Some content may be out of date until this process is complete.” While Harry has not publicly commented on his title change, it does not come as a huge surprise, since after he and wife Meghan Markle in January 2020, Buckingham Palace announced, “The Sussexes will not use their HRH titles as they are no longer working members of the Royal Family.” Harry—son of King Charles and the late Princess Diana—was born a prince and named the Duke of Sussex by grandmother Queen Elizabeth upon his marriage to Meghan in 2018.

Meghan was then named the Duchess of Sussex. Upon on September 8, 2022, Harry and Meghan’s children, Archie and Lilibet, earned their default titles of prince and princess. At the time, the royal website to reflect the change. The Sussexes now live in Montecito, California, and remain non-working royals.

What is the procession after a funeral?

Christianity – Funeral procession of Empress with a horse-drawn hearse in, 1826. Christian funeral procession by car in Brighton and Hove, East Sussex, England, 2009 In the Christian religion, the funeral procession was originally from the home of the deceased to the church because this was the only procession associated with burial.

This is because the burial took place on the church property so there was no procession that occurred after the funeral service. Later on, as the deceased began to be buried in cemeteries that were not at the church, the main funeral procession was considered to be from the church to the place of burial.

This switch was mainly due to the monastic influence over time. When the place of burial was at the church or nearby, the body was carried to the grave/tomb. Those carrying the coffin were led by others carrying wax candles and incense. The incense signify a sign of honor for the deceased.

In the modern day, the funeral procession is no longer common or practiced in the same way. Now a hearse is used to transport the body to the gravesite. The procession consists of carrying the casket from the church to the hearse and then from the hearse to the gravesite once at the cemetery. The male family members and friends are typically the ones who carry the coffin.
